I've crawled about on some relatively fragile racking, over 500 amp 'buzz-bars'.....Running a cable from one side to the other.

"Am I really allowed to do this ?" I queried my colleagues in the exchange..."This racking isn't particularly strong."

"No.....But you're the lightest by far...Get it done quick before anyone spots you."

Needless to say, I didn't come into contact with the buzz-bars......unlike a screwdriver that allegedly fell between the bars when the exchange was being 'wired up'.
It hit the floor from about 15 feet up, and landed as a hot lump of melted metal and plastic. (Apparently.) :-\

Worked on a job with, amongst others, a sparks who was doing a major rewiring job on a very large building.

It involved working on stuff behind a pair of very large bus bars. We identified the risk and so the power to the bus bars was turned off, the work completed, power restored ... and then the guy realised he'd left a screwdriver behind and without thinking reached between the bus bars to pick it up.

Fortunately I was neither lead Project Manager nor on site at the time and so didn't need to attend the inquest :-(

Be safe people.
